There's a lot here. The main thing is that rather than invoking `INNER_UNMAKE_PACKAGE`, we use the new `mach artifact install --unfiltered-project-package` flag to do that work. In automation, this gets configured using `MOZ_ARTIFACT_TASK` and is deterministic; locally, this is far easier to work with. This replacement allows us to clean up a bunch of Makefile goo, some of which is done here. More clean up is surely possible; the `mozharness` config files are a good place to look next. The `MOZ_PKG_MAC_*` settings previously referred to the unpacked DMG resources. There's no need for that complication; we can always take them from the branding resources. (The relevant `mozconfig` entries *look* to always have Nightly branding, but merge automation ensures that the branding is correctly set for Beta and Release.) # Shared makefile that can be used to easily kick off l10n builds
|
|
# of Mozilla applications.
|
|
# This makefile should be included, and then assumes that the including
|
|
# makefile defines the following targets:
|
|
# l10n-%
|
|
# This target should call into the various l10n targets that this
|
|
# application depends on.
|
|
# installer-%
|
|
# This target should list all required targets, a typical rule would be
|
|
# installers-%: clobber-% langpack-% repackage-zip-%
|
|
# @echo "repackaging done"
|
|
# to initially clobber the locale staging area, and then to build the
|
|
# language pack and zip package.
|
|
# Other targets like windows installers might be listed, too, and should
|
|
# be defined in the including makefile.
|
|
# The installer-% targets should not set AB_CD, so that the unpackaging
|
|
# step finds the original package.
|
|
# The including makefile should provide values for the variables
|
|
# MOZ_APP_VERSION and MOZ_LANGPACK_EID.
